일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
- Binding
- listview
- typescript
- Flutter
- GitHub
- db
- HTML
- 깃허브
- 닷넷
- React JS
- Maui
- page
- spring boot
- 바인딩
- Firebase
- MVVM
- 리엑트
- 파이어베이스
- 오류
- 플러터
- AnimationController
- MS-SQL
- Animation
- 자바스크립트
- JavaScript
- 함수
- MSSQL
- 애니메이션
- 마우이
- .NET
- Today
- Total
목록언더바 (2)
개발노트
Java 에서 "_" 언더바 사용은 아래와 같은 문제를 불러옵니다.Naming Conventions: Java의 명명 규칙(Naming Conventions)은 카멜 표기법(Camel Case)을 따릅니다. 즉, 변수 이름은 소문자로 시작하고, 여러 단어가 결합될 때는 각 단어의 첫 글자를 대문자로 표기합니다. 이러한 명명 규칙을 따르지 않으면 코드의 가독성이 떨어지고, 표준에 맞지 않는 코드로 인식될 수 있습니다.키워드와의 충돌: 언더바(_)는 Java에서 특별한 용도로 사용되는 문자가 아니기 때문에 문법적으로는 문제가 없지만, 키워드와의 충돌이 발생할 수 있습니다. 예를 들어, 변수 이름으로 **int _value;**와 같이 언더바를 사용하면 일부 상황에서 코드를 해석하는 데 혼란을 줄 수 있습니다..
DB를 조회하다보면 가끔 %(퍼센트)나 _(언더바) 기호가 포함된 문자열을 조회해야 할때가 있습니다. 문제점 하지만, Like문에서 '%'는 문자 앞이나 뒤에 사용하여 앞뒤에 문자, 길이 상관없이 조회할 수 있는 와일드카드로 사용되고, '_'는 어떤 문자가와도 관계없으나 '_'가 사용된 수만큼 글자수를 지정하는 와일드카드로 사용됩니다. 해결방법 Like문에 사용되는 와일드카드 '%'와 '_'를 문자로 인식하게 하려면 ESCAPE를 사용하면됩니다. 예를들어 "_" 언더바가 들어있는 문자열을 조회하려면 ESCAPE 문자를 지정하고 ESCAPE 문자 뒤에 와일드카드 문자를 작성하면된다. Select 칼럼명 From 테이블명 Where 칼럼명 Like '%&_문자열%' ESCAPE '&' ▶ 문자열 앞에 '_'..